Alternatively, call for the records and issue a writ of mandamus or any other appropriate writ, order or direction, directing the 3rdrespondent to consider and pass appropriate orders in EXT.P.3(a) interlocutory application for condonation of delay and EXT.P.4(b) & EXT.P.5(b) interlocutory applications for stay as expeditiously as possible.” 2.The petitioner, who is a widow, was dependent on the income of her late husband Mr. Jayaprakash P, who was an auto rickshaw driver. The assessment under Section 147 r/w Section 144 and Section 144B of the Income Tax Act, 1961 ( ‘the IT Act’ for short) was completed in respect of the assessment year 2014-2015 of the income of the petitioner’s husband. 3. According to the learned counsel for the petitioner, an amount of Rs. 1,25,20,000/- was reported by the Bank to the income tax WP(C) NO. 41318 OF 2023 3 authority and the said amount was added under Section 69A of the IT Act, as the income from other sources. The assessment order was finalized with the tax, penalty and interest demand. Lear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that the petitioner’s husband never had this kind of money and the statement of the bank would disclose that said amount was never remitted to the account of the petitioner’s husband. 4.Considering the said fact and circumstances and also taken into consideration that appeals have been filed in Exts.P3(a), Ext.P4(b) and Ext.P5(b) against the Exts.P1, P4 and P5 orders, this court deem it appropriate to direct the 3rd respondent to consider and pass appropriate orders on the delay application and stay application filed along with the appeals, as expeditiously as possible, preferably within a period of two months. No recovery shall be effected from the petitioner in respect of the orders in Exts.P1, P4 and P5 till then. The writ petition is disposed of as above.
